Tiirismaa School is located on the Paavola campus in the center of Lahti. Approximately 850 students in grades 1 to 9 study at our comprehensive school, and about 90 adults work in educational roles. In addition to Finnish-language instruction, Tiirismaa offers English stream, extensive bilingual basic education (English – Finnish) for grades 1 to 9, as well as focused music education for grades 7 to 9. The upper secondary education of the Swedish-speaking school in Lahti is also provided in connection with Tiirismaa School.

The basic education services of Lahti belong to the education sector, which is responsible for organizing education, upbringing, sports, and cultural services, as well as developing the entire service area. The education sector is innovative, values expertise, and is an active partner. Basic education is provided in 21 schools. There are just over 10,000 students and around 1,200 teachers and educational assistants.
